Output 19dfaca5fa14852395d341ac6254364118a8a8633af16333205a1a9be3bc8e73:13

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ff862b4cccc2bc53ad8142ba2f1ecde5c761d1 OP_EQUAL
address
39ttAk1CZCBiQxDWsZQhW3mNMhzQRnghXV
transaction
19dfaca5fa14852395d341ac6254364118a8a8633af16333205a1a9be3bc8e73
spent
true